150W Split High Peak Power MOPA Fiber Laser
SPECTRAWAVE-HIGH PEAK POWER-150-1-HPP pulse width tunable fiber laser utilizes direct electrical modulation semiconductor laser as seed source (MOPA), delivering exceptional laser characteristics and precise pulse shape control capabilities.
Key Features
- Independently adjustable working pulse width: 1-500ns
- High pulse repetition frequency up to 10,000 kHz
- Single pulse energy exceeding 1.0 mJ
- High peak power output up to 100 kW
- Excellent output beam quality with spot roundness >90%
- Dual output modes: pulse and continuous wave laser
- Stable performance across temperature ranges (0-35°C)
- Water-cooled design for maintenance-free operation
Industrial Applications
- Glass drilling and dicing operations
- Specialized metal spot welding
- Anode and coating stripping processes
- Ceramic scribing and resistance fine adjustment
- Photovoltaic single crystal/polysilicon dicing
- Metal deep engraving, marking, welding, and cutting
- Continuous processing of high reaction materials
Technical Specifications
| Parameter | Unit | Value |
|---|---|---|
| Central wavelength | nm | 1050-1070 |
| Average power | W | 150 |
| Highest peak power | kW | >100 |
| Pulse width range | ns | 1-500 |
| Frequency range | kHz | 5-10000 |
| Maximum pulse energy | mJ | 1 |
| Beam quality | - | <1.4 |
| Working voltage | V | 48 |
| Working current | A | <13 |
| Working temperature | °C | 0-35 |
| Refrigeration mode | - | Water cooling |
| Overall dimensions | mm | 439×397×88+360×200×73 |
